Question 2005 4Runner Vibration

I have a 2005 4Runner and tonight I noticed thast if I drive with one of the back windows down it feels like there is a helicopter hovering above the vehicle. If I put one of there other windows down, there is no problem. Has anyone else had a problem like this? I am thinking it is an aerodynamics issue.

Yeah, it is a problem with airflow. I have noticed it if I open the the rear door windows about half way. It goes away when I crack the sun roof open. I also noticed the same type of problem on a PT Cruiser I rented once. Sometimes it can be quite loud.

it happens on alot of cars. just have more than one window open. It lets the air flow through so it doesn't create that "helicopter" noise.
